<h3 style="text-align:left;">Overview of the Cyberattack and Its Impact</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">Columbia University initially detected a potentially severe cyberattack after experiencing a network outage in June. Following the incident, university officials reported that unauthorized access to their systems led to a massive data breach. The notification process for those affected began on August 7 and continues on a rolling basis, reflecting the complex nature of the breach. This incident has not only triggered concern among the university community but has also drawn the attention of cybersecurity experts and law enforcement.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">The breach includes sensitive data from current and former students as well as employees and applicants. The magnitude of the affected individuals, nearing 869,000, illustrates the far-reaching implications of such cyberattacks, emphasizing the need for improved cybersecurity measures in academic institutions.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Data Compromised in the Breach</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">According to breach notifications filed with the Maine Attorney General&#8217;s office, the compromised data includes a mix of personal and sensitive information. The extent of the breach encompasses approximately 460 gigabytes of stolen data. Columbia University confirmed that the categories of exposed information are quite severe and include:</p>
<ul style="text-align:left;">
<li>Names, dates of birth, and social security numbers</li>
<li>Contact details and demographic information</li>
<li>Academic history and financial aid records</li>
<li>Insurance information and some health-related details</li>
</ul>
<p style="text-align:left;">Despite the vast array of compromised records, Columbia emphasized that patient records from the Columbia University Irving Medical Center were not affected. However, concerns over identity theft, fraud, and the potential misuse of personal information have cast a shadow over the university&#8217;s reputation and the safety of its community.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Columbia University&#8217;s Response Actions</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">In the wake of the cyberattack, Columbia University has taken proactive steps to address the breach and reassess its cybersecurity protocols. They have engaged law enforcement for further investigation while collaborating with cybersecurity experts to analyze the situation comprehensively. As part of their response strategy, the institution has introduced new safeguards and enhanced existing protocols to prevent similar incidents in the future.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">Furthermore, Columbia began dispatching notifications to those affected on August 7, offering two years of complimentary credit monitoring and identity theft restoration services. While the university has stated that there is currently no evidence suggesting the stolen data has been misused, there remains an ongoing risk given the time-sensitive nature of identity theft operations.</p>

<h3 style="text-align:left;">Urging Compliance with Federal Demands</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">The letter penned by Dr. <strong>Shoshana Shendelman</strong> is a direct appeal to Columbia University’s leadership to comply with the Trump administration&#8217;s expected actions regarding antisemitism on campus. In her correspondence, Shendelman argued that the university’s recent handling of antisemitism claims reveals a severe lack of moral clarity. The letter indicates that she believes current leadership has failed to protect Jewish students and the broader university community, creating a hazardous campus environment. </p>
<p style="text-align:left;">“The conduct exhibited by Columbia leadership in recent months demonstrates a disturbing lack of moral clarity and poses a significant threat to the safety and well-being of Jewish students, faculty, and the broader community of Columbia University,” Shendelman stated. She called for the university to take immediate action if it wishes to avoid severe repercussions.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Background of the Controversy</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">The controversy surrounding Columbia University has been brewing amid accusations of rising antisemitism, particularly following the October 7, 2023, attack on Israel by Hamas. These events have drawn national and local attention, prompting representatives, including Republicans, to call for accountability within educational institutions. The recent communication from Dr. Shendelman comes on the heel of messages disclosed by acting university President <strong>Claire Shipman</strong>, suggesting potential exclusionary measures aimed at Shendelman, who is Jewish and of Iranian ancestry.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">Among the messages released, Shipman voiced a desire to diversify the board by seeking an Arab trustee, raising further questions about her management of sensitive campus issues. The interplay between these communications and the larger issue of antisemitism on campus has led many to demand a more robust response from university leadership.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">University Response and Ongoing Investigations</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">In response to Dr. Shendelman’s letter, the university has remained vague about its future steps. Following the release of the controversial messages, Shipman issued an apology to various board members and alumni, though it notably did not mention Shendelman directly. Critics are evaluating whether this acknowledgment is sufficient for the serious concerns raised about antisemitism and the campus&#8217;s culture. </p>
<p style="text-align:left;">The Education Department has also become involved, expressing intentions to review Columbia&#8217;s compliance with Title VI of the Civil Rights Act, which prohibits racial and national origin discrimination by organizations receiving federal funds. This scrutiny coincides with a broader examination of antisemitism across educational institutions nationwide. Columbia’s failure to adequately tackle these issues has prompted investigations, particularly after the Education Department hinted at accreditation challenges for non-compliance.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Financial Implications for Columbia University</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">The financial ramifications surrounding this situation are significant. In March, the Education Department rescinded $400 million in grants and contracts awarded to Columbia due to &#8220;continued inaction in the face of persistent harassment&#8221; directed at Jewish students. This retraction of funds not only impacts the university&#8217;s operations but also raises concerns about long-term financial sustainability.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">Columbia University traditionally relies on a plethora of federal grants, exceeding $5 billion, to fund various programs and initiatives. The cessation of federal support creates not only immediate budgetary pressures but could also impede ongoing projects and future planning. As the federal government conducts a comprehensive review of Columbia&#8217;s contracts, the potential for further financial penalties looms heavily over the institution.</p>

<h3 style="text-align:left;">Background on Khalil&#8217;s Arrest</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">The tumultuous saga of <strong>Mahmoud Khalil</strong> began when immigration authorities apprehended him at the Columbia University housing complex in March. Initially a student activist advocating for Palestinian rights, the 30-year-old was swiftly escorted to a detention center in Louisiana, illustrating the government&#8217;s increasingly stringent measures against dissenting voices. The timing of the arrest coincided with Khalil&#8217;s participation in a significant protest against the ongoing conflict in Gaza, which has claimed numerous lives. His case stands out as particularly egregious due to the methods employed by immigration authorities in apprehending individuals involved in political activism.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Khalil&#8217;s Reaction and Messaging</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">Upon his return to Newark International Airport, <strong>Mahmoud Khalil</strong> spoke defiantly to reporters and supporters, stressing the urgency of the Palestinian plight. &#8220;Your messages have kept me going,&#8221; he asserted, highlighting his commitment to ongoing protests. Khalil&#8217;s words were laced with conviction as he criticized the U.S. government&#8217;s role in funding what he termed a &#8220;genocide&#8221; in Gaza. Standing alongside his wife, Dr. <strong>Noor Abdalla</strong>, and Congresswoman <strong>Alexandria Ocasio-Cortez</strong>, Khalil made his sentiments known about the broader implications of his detainment. &#8220;Even if they would kill me, I would still speak up for Gaza,&#8221; he emphatically stated, showcasing his unwavering dedication to his cause.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Political Reactions and Implications</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">The aftermath of Khalil&#8217;s detainment has reignited a national debate surrounding civil liberties and political expression. Congresswoman <strong>Ocasio-Cortez</strong> condemned Khalil’s arrest as politically motivated, emphasizing its implications on the First Amendment rights of all citizens. &#8220;Everybody agrees that persecution based on political speech is wrong,&#8221; she remarked, framing the detainment as an affront to democratic principles. As public sentiments swell against the government&#8217;s actions, Khalil’s situation acts as a catalyst for reform discussions on immigration policies and civil rights protections. His case invites scrutiny of the Trump administration’s stance on national security, positioning Khalil not just as a protestor but as a symbol of a broader movement for justice and free expression.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Details of Khalil&#8217;s Detention</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">During his time in the Louisiana detention center, <strong>Mahmoud Khalil</strong> faced severe emotional and psychological challenges. Reports indicated his unjust treatment during a period when he could not be with his wife, who gave birth during his incarceration. His brief statements upon release captured a mix of relief and bitterness: &#8220;Although justice prevailed, it&#8217;s long, very long overdue,&#8221; he expressed, reflecting on how the legal and immigration systems struggled to uphold civil rights. The accusations against him, which included claims related to his work history and political affiliations, raised questions about the validity and fairness of government procedures surrounding his detainment. A complex web of allegations was constructed from unverified sources, demonstrating the fragility of due process in politically charged scenarios.</p>

<h3 style="text-align:left;">Court Ruling on Detention Attempt</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">The preliminary injunction issued by Judge <strong>Naomi Reice Buchwald</strong> is a crucial legal protection for <strong>Yunseo Chung</strong>, assuring that ICE cannot detain her without proper judicial oversight. This ruling is set against the backdrop of attempts by immigration authorities to arrest Chung on March 8. The judge’s ruling mandates that any future attempt to detain Chung would require a 72-hour notice to her legal representatives, allowing the court adequate time to evaluate whether the detention is justified or if it serves as retaliation for her First Amendment activities.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">Chung&#8217;s case exemplifies the intersection between immigration enforcement and freedom of speech. The court’s decision not only safeguards her from immediate deportation but also underscores the larger implications tied to governmental overreach in matters of free expression. By ensuring her legal representation can challenge any potential wrongful detention, the ruling reinforces judicial oversight over immigration enforcement practices.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Legal Representation and Advocacy</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">Representing <strong>Yunseo Chung</strong> is <strong>Ramzi Kassem</strong>, co-director of CLEAR, a legal nonprofit aligned with the City University of New York. Kassem has hailed the judge&#8217;s ruling as a victory for not just Chung, but also for all advocates standing in solidarity with the Palestinian cause. In his statement, Kassem emphasized, </p>
<blockquote style="text-align:left;"><p>&#8220;This is a win not just for Yunseo&#8230; but also for freedom of speech and the rule of law in our country.&#8221;</p></blockquote>
<p style="text-align:left;">Chung&#8217;s legal pursuits began earlier in the year when her case was filed against the government, alleging that her participation in protests was wrongly construed as a risk to U.S. foreign policy. Kassem’s advocacy work centers on protecting the rights of individuals who engage in social justice activism, illustrating the challenges inherent within the current political climate where activism can lead to punitive actions against protesters.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Government Claims and Controversy</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">The Trump administration&#8217;s portrayal of Chung&#8217;s protest participation suggests potential risks to U.S. foreign policy, an assertion that has sparked substantial debate. The government has framed Chung&#8217;s activism—focused on raising awareness about the conflict in Gaza—as a serious security concern. This narrative aligns with broader efforts to scrutinize activists, especially in contexts where U.S. foreign relations are involved.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">However, Chung&#8217;s attorneys have vehemently challenged this perspective, arguing that her actions fall under protected speech rights. The lawsuit specifies that she was merely participating as one of many students voicing their concerns regarding the situation in Gaza. This ongoing tension highlights fundamental issues surrounding national security and the thresholds of acceptable dissent in contemporary American society.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Plaintiff&#8217;s Academic Background</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">Academically, <strong>Yunseo Chung</strong> represents a model student, demonstrating academic excellence with a near-perfect GPA during her senior year at Columbia University where she is double-majoring in English and Women’s and Gender Studies. Her history as a valedictorian in high school exemplifies a dedication to her education, a background which makes the government&#8217;s actions even more contentious.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">Despite her academic success, Chung has faced significant challenges due to her legal battles. The government has alleged—without proof—that her stance in protests justifies drastic actions like deportation, despite her previously unblemished academic record. <h3 style="text-align:left;">Allegations Against Columbia University</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">The U.S. Education Department&#8217;s investigation into Columbia University began in early February, focusing on allegations of discrimination and harassment involving Jewish students and faculty. The inquiry centers on whether the university has been enabling a hostile environment contrary to Title VI of the Civil Rights Act. This legislation prohibits discrimination on the basis of race, color, or national origin among recipients of federal funding, which includes most colleges and universities across the nation. Underlining the gravity of the situation, Education Secretary <strong>Linda McMahon</strong> stated, &#8220;After Hamas&#8217; October 7, 2023, terror attack on Israel, Columbia University&#8217;s leadership acted with deliberate indifference towards the harassment of Jewish students on its campus.&#8221; This caught the attention of federal authorities due to the implications such behavior has for federal funding and student safety.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Federal Oversight and Compliance Standards</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">The Office of Civil Rights (OCR) issued a formal notification to the Middle States Commission on Higher Education, the body responsible for accrediting Columbia, regarding the university&#8217;s alleged violations. According to federal regulations, accreditors are mandated to inform their member institutions about any federal noncompliance findings and to establish a corrective action plan. The Education Department clarified that if Columbia fails to remedy these issues within a specified timeframe, the accrediting agency could be required to take action against the university. Such actions could include suspension or revocation of its accreditation status, which would have dire consequences for its eligibility to receive federal student aid such as loans and Pell Grants.</p>

<h3 style="text-align:left;">Overview of the Incident at Columbia</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">The situation at Columbia University unfolded on Wednesday evening, as a group of pro-Palestinian demonstrators occupied Butler Library. Reports indicate that around 76 protesters were taken into custody by NYPD officers, following a series of escalating confrontations between the demonstrators and university public safety personnel. The NYPD&#8217;s involvement was prompted by a request from the university after demonstrators reportedly refused to disperse following orders from Columbia&#8217;s public safety team.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">The unrest began earlier in the day when students noticed growing chaos inside the library. Video footage captured the moment protesters surged into the building, taking over a room and allegedly vandalizing property. Witnesses quickly identified the presence of a premeditated plan among protesters, raising concerns about the level of organization behind the demonstration. The ensuing chaos led to injury among public safety officers, prompting an increased response from law enforcement.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">As the standoff continued into the evening, a fire alarm sounded, and emergency medical responders were witnessed escorting at least one individual out of the library on a stretcher. Tensions escalated outside as crowds gathered to support the demonstrators, resulting in clashes with police, further complicating the situation.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">The Context Behind the Protest</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">The protests at Columbia University are not isolated incidents but part of a broader movement for Palestinian rights that has gained traction among students nationwide. The timing of the demonstration was particularly notable, taking place during a critical pre-final exam period. This led university officials and students alike to voice their concerns over the disruption caused during a moment when academic focus was paramount.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">Student groups have expressed that they intended their protest as a peaceful demonstration advocating for Palestinian rights. However, as tensions escalated and violence broke out, the narrative shifted. Concerns surrounding organized actions against the university’s policies were echoed by university officials, emphasizing that while the right to protest is fundamental, any actions veering towards violence or vandalism cannot be condoned.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">The protesters reportedly stormed the library as a response to what they viewed as systemic issues stemming from the university&#8217;s stance on Middle Eastern geopolitical matters. Earlier protests had occurred at Columbia over similar topics, but the intensity and organization behind this particular gathering reflected an evolution in tactics that drew immediate attention from administration and law enforcement alike.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Responses from University and City Officials</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">Following the chaotic events, multiple officials released statements surrounding the incident. NYC Mayor <strong>Eric Adams</strong> expressed his gratitude toward public safety officials and reinforced the city&#8217;s stance on lawful protests. In a statement, he reiterated, </p>
<blockquote style="text-align:left;"><p>&#8220;Everyone has the right to peacefully protest. But violence, vandalism or destruction of property are completely unacceptable.&#8221;</p></blockquote>
<p style="text-align:left;">Columbia University officials responded to the incident by emphasizing their commitment to maintaining a safe educational environment. Acting President <strong>Claire Shipman</strong> issued a directive to request NYPD assistance due to safety concerns stemming from the protests, stating that the presence of law enforcement was necessary to secure the building and safety of the community. In her statement, Shipman noted, </p>
<blockquote style="text-align:left;"><p>&#8220;Requesting the presence of the NYPD is not the outcome we wanted, but it was absolutely necessary to secure the safety of our community.&#8221;</p></blockquote>
<p style="text-align:left;">While officials recognized the right to protest, they also outlined disciplinary consequences for individuals violating university policies during the incident. Columbia&#8217;s administration asserted its expectation that students prioritize academic activities, especially during a crucial examination period.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Perspectives from Students and Activists</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">The reactions from students involved in the protest were mixed, with some expressing solidarity with the activists while others voiced concern over the interrupted academic environment. Student <strong>Eden Yadegar</strong>, who was studying in the library at the time, described the chaos: &#8220;A group of a few dozen who I would assume are students, covered in masks and hoodies, stormed through the entrance, shoving some public safety officers.&#8221; This led to her noting how quickly the situation deteriorated.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">Some students felt that their academic pursuits were unduly disrupted by the protest, expressing discomfort with the actions taken. A student, identified as <strong>Franziska Sittig</strong>, articulated that a small minority of students had managed to disrupt the entire campus experience, raising questions about collective responsibility when direct actions sidelined the needs of many. Her comments reflected the dual nature of the protests as both a form of expression and a disruption to collective academic goals.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">On the other hand, members of the activist community positioned the demonstration as a vital expression of political solidarity in the face of societal injustices. They contended their actions were a necessary response to broader issues, including systemic racism and imperialism affecting Palestinian communities. Their statements, disseminated through social media platforms, communicated their resolve to continue their advocacy despite the consequences they faced.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Implications of the Event on Campus Life</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">The aftereffects of the incident at Butler Library will likely reverberate throughout Columbia&#8217;s campus life. Following the protest, the university announced that guest access would be suspended and that identification would be required for entrance to university buildings moving forward. <h3 style="text-align:left;">Details of the Record-Breaking Settlement</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">The recent settlement reached between Columbia University and the victims of <strong>Robert Hadden</strong> has set a new precedent in the context of medical malpractice and abuse cases. Approved by the Manhattan Supreme Court on Monday, the agreement will see nearly 600 survivors receive an average of $1.3 million each, further solidifying Columbia&#8217;s financial obligation to provide restitution for the immense suffering caused by Hadden during his tenure as a gynecologist. Notably, this amount is part of the over $1 billion that Columbia will be liable for following previous settlements related to Hadden&#8217;s predation.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Historical Context of Abuse at Columbia</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">Hadden&#8217;s malpractice spanned over a significant period, where he sexually abused numerous patients, often utilizing his position of power and trust. Despite a history of complaints lodged against him, institutional responses were inadequate. In 2023, Hadden was sentenced to two decades in prison after being found guilty of exploiting vulnerable individuals, including minors. Columbia University and its affiliated hospitals, such as New York-Presbyterian, were repeatedly criticized for prioritizing their reputations over patient welfare.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">Evidence of Hadden&#8217;s misconduct had been surfacing for years, but it was not until recent legal scrutiny that the depth of the issue became visible. The attorney representing the plaintiffs, <strong>Anthony T. DiPietro</strong>, emphasized that hidden documents revealed a long-standing awareness of Hadden&#8217;s behavior by the university&#8217;s administration, raising questions about their moral and ethical responsibilities.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Victim Responses and Institutional Accountability</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">As the news of the settlement broke, many victims expressed a bittersweet sense of justice, with <strong>Laurie Maldonando</strong>, a victim herself, openly stating, </p>
<blockquote style="text-align:left;"><p>&#8220;This settlement is not about money — it&#8217;s about accountability.&#8221;</p></blockquote>
<p> This sentiment reflects a growing demand for changes in institutional governance and a need for transparent practices to protect patients. The payout serves not just as compensation but as a critical acknowledgment of the suffering endured by the victims.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">Maldonando and other survivors have indicated that Columbia&#8217;s actions of addressing the issue only after being backed into a corner is emblematic of a larger, systemic problem within healthcare institutions—doing too little, too late. The settlements highlight the complex interplay between victim advocacy, institutional denial, and the potential for reform.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Legal Actions and Future Implications</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">The ongoing legal battles surrounding Hadden&#8217;s case signal a shift towards greater scrutiny of medical professionals and those who enable them. DiPietro has been a prominent figure in the fight for the survivors’ rights, managing to secure $277 million in prior settlements before this monumental agreement. Additionally, he stated that his team&#8217;s investigations revealed crucial documents that indicated conscious neglect on the part of Columbia’s administration regarding patient safety.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">The implications of these legal actions extend far beyond merely compensating individual victims. They emphasize accountability and set a precedent for how similar cases may be handled in the future, particularly with regard to policies governing healthcare practitioners. Strengthening these measures is essential in fostering transparency, which should result in better patient care and safety.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Continuing Challenges Amidst Reform Attempts</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">While the settlement represents progress, challenges remain in ensuring lasting changes are made across the healthcare system. Columbia&#8217;s commitment to establishing a $100 million fund for victims was described as &#8220;woefully inadequate&#8221; by DiPietro. There are calls for patients to feel safe in seeking medical attention without fearing institutional betrayal.</p>
<p style="text-align:left;">In an open statement, a spokesperson for Columbia acknowledged the pain suffered by the patients, committing to ongoing efforts to repair harm and support survivors. Initiatives to improve patient safety policies have been enacted, fueled by the need to confront a history of negligence. However, critics argue these measures do not go far enough and stress the need for an independent investigation into other potential cases of abuse within the institution.</p>

<h3 style="text-align:left;">Columbia University’s Policy Revisions</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">Columbia University has recently made significant changes to its policies in response to ongoing criticism regarding antisemitism on its campus. This includes a reevaluation of how protests are managed, an expansion of its Jewish studies program, and adjustments to administrative oversight of its Middle Eastern studies program. These steps were taken following the university&#8217;s concerns about potentially losing substantial federal funding if it failed to address issues surrounding antisemitism adequately. The university has publicly stated that it is committed to fostering an inclusive environment for all students, emphasizing its dedication to addressing and eradicating antisemitic behavior.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">The Role of the Consent Decree</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">A consent decree serves as a formal agreement that is authorized by a court, often used to ensure that organizational compliance with laws is maintained. In this case, the Trump administration is pursuing this legal mechanism to reinforce Columbia&#8217;s commitment to the policies aimed at countering antisemitism. The administration’s strategy may include establishing a court-enforceable agreement mandating a compliance framework. If Columbia were found to be in contempt of court due to non-compliance, it could face various legal and financial repercussions, thus creating an added layer of accountability for the institution.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Antisemitism Allegations and Federal Funding</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">The backdrop to these recent actions is a series of allegations regarding antisemitism at Columbia University that have not only sparked public discourse but have also posed a significant threat to the university’s funding. The Trump administration previously threatened to withdraw approximately $400 million in federal funding due to Columbia&#8217;s approach to managing issues related to antisemitism. In response to these pressures, the university has undertaken numerous policy changes. Although Columbia asserts that it is on the right path to addressing the issues and restoring its federal funding, substantive progress will likely be under scrutiny as efforts to formalize a consent decree advance.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Administration&#8217;s Concerns About Compliance</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">There is a perception, based on leaked information from sources close to the administration, that officials harbor doubts about Columbia’s commitment to uphold the federal directives regarding antisemitism seriously. This skepticism plays a pivotal role in the administration’s decision to formulate the consent decree. By ensuring a legally binding framework is established, the administration aims to dispel doubts over whether Columbia will genuinely follow through on its policy commitments beyond mere public relations efforts. The scrutiny surrounding Columbia’s compliance trajectory is indicative of a broader concern among federal officials regarding how universities can effectively handle issues of antisemitism.</p>
<h3 style="text-align:left;">Background Context: Previous Consent Decrees</h3>
<p style="text-align:left;">While the usage of consent decrees can vary significantly across different administrations, they have historically been leveraged by various government entities to enforce compliance with established policies. For example, the previous Biden administration employed similar decrees to drive criminal justice reforms among police departments and ensured adherence to federal antisemitism guidelines among several universities, including Brown and Rutgers. These precedents highlight the ongoing trend of governmental use of consent decrees as a method for securing adherence to policy frameworks and the ways in which such legal mechanisms have been applied in addressing sensitive community issues, such as antisemitism.</p>
